What are the key skills and qualifications needed to thrive as a Technology Engineer, and why are they important?

To thrive as a Technology Engineer, you need a solid background in engineering principles, computer science, and problem-solving, usually supported by a relevant bachelor's degree. Familiarity with programming languages, CAD software, and systems like Linux or cloud platforms, as well as certifications such as CompTIA or Cisco, is often required. Strong analytical thinking, collaboration, and effective communication distinguish outstanding professionals in this field. These skills enable Technology Engineers to design, implement, and maintain complex systems that drive innovation and operational efficiency.

What are Technology Engineers?

Technology Engineers are professionals who design, develop, implement, and maintain technological solutions for businesses and organizations. They work with both hardware and software systems, ensuring that technology infrastructure operates efficiently and meets the needs of users. Their responsibilities can include troubleshooting technical problems, optimizing system performance, and integrating new technologies. Technology Engineers often collaborate with other IT specialists and stakeholders to deliver effective solutions. They play a crucial role in keeping organizations competitive and up-to-date with the latest technological advancements.

Job description

Job Summary:

This entry level/early career professional, laboratory test focused position designs or specifies test systems that allow operation of Cummins' products in a laboratory environment for engineering evaluation to optimize our product designs.  This position also involves the specification, design, implementation, validation and support of test systems including mechanical, electrical, plumbing, instrumentation, data acquisition and control systems.

Key Responsibilities:

Investigates product test system and process problems, understands causal mechanisms, recommends appropriate action, owns problem resolution and documents results with guidance from more experienced team members. Applies and supports the improvement of processes such as test system specification, design and validation and tools such as FMEA, 7-step problem solving, and process hazard analysis, required to support the processes and enable high quality decision making. Obtains input and negotiates with lab customers, lab technicians, and component suppliers and delivers test system requirements, processes, and instructions to lab technicians, product functional test engineers and equipment suppliers. Makes decisions in the areas of component selection, calibration processes, and operating processes that impact test equipment accuracy, reliability and operating cost. Owns problem resolution for moderately complex components, products, systems, subsystems or services with technical complexity and ambiguity increasing as experience is gained in the role. Provides independent execution of established work processes and systems, while still developing technology or product knowledge; engages with the improvement of systems and processes. Involves minimal direct management of people, but could involve the coordination and direction of work amongst technicians and/or temporary student employees. Contributes effectively toward team goals, exhibits influence within a work group and continues to develop proficiency in the competency areas critical to success in the role.

Competencies:
Function Based Product Testing of "X" - Selects appropriate equipment and techniques to operate the product and record operational data in a hardware or software based testing environment most often required as part of a product verification or validation plan; evaluates quality and validity of measurement data; analyzes test results using accepted standards to characterize product capabilities in alignment with the requirements of the engineer responsible for making product decisions.
Laboratory Equipment Safety - Evaluates hazards specific to laboratory test equipment that may result from fuels, kinetic energy, toxins, electrical or other risks in the test environment; analyzes risk factors and potential impacts to personnel and property; applies appropriate techniques or safeguards to mitigate risks; collaborates with various laboratory areas to understand risks within a facility or site.
Product Function Test System Design - Interprets test equipment specifications from test standards or lab customer requirements; selects and integrates appropriate equipment, instrumentation and software to control boundary conditions and collect measurement data; assesses capability of the lab equipment against the requirements and support infrastructure.
Collaborates - Building partnerships and working collaboratively with others to meet shared objectives.
Communicates effectively - Developing and delivering multi-mode communications that convey a clear understanding of the unique needs of different audiences.
Decision quality - Making good and timely decisions that keep the organization moving forward.
Drives results - Consistently achieving results, even under tough circumstances.
Self-development - Actively seeking new ways to grow and be challenged using both formal and informal development channels.
Data Quality - Identifies, understands and corrects flaws in data that supports effective information governance across operational business processes and decision making.
Measurement Science - Analyzes measurement processes throughout the relevant traceability chain to identify and quantify sources of measurement uncertainty relevant to the appropriate applied measurement science, "Metrology" e.g. Chemical, Dimensional, Electrical, Mechanical, Optical and Radiation and Physical.
Project Management - Establishes and maintains the balance of scope, schedule and resources for a temporary effort (a "project"). Ensures results/impact from temporary effort are fully realized as possible.
Values differences - Recognizing the value that different perspectives and cultures bring to an organization.
Problem Solving - Solves problems and may mentor others on effective problem solving by using a systematic analysis process by leveraging industry standard methodologies to create problem traceability and protect the customer; determines the assignable cause; implements robust, data-based solutions; identifies the systemic root causes and ensures actions to prevent problem reoccurrence are implemented.

Cummins Inc., headquartered in Columbus, IN, US, is a global power leader that designs, manufactures, and distributes numerous power products and systems. With its genesis from as early as 1919, the company readily serves diverse industries such as transportation, industrial, generator drive, or marine applications, among others. At the heart of Cummins' operations, its key product lineup encompasses diesel & natural gas engines, generator sets, engine components, and filtration, emission solutions, and electrical power generation systems.
